柯林斯词典
- N-TITLE 夫人,太太(用于已婚女士姓名前)
Mrsis used before the name of a married woman when you are speaking or referring to her.- Hello, Mrs Miles.
您好,迈尔斯夫人。 - ...Mrs Anne Pritchard.
安妮·普里查德夫人 - ...Mr and Mrs D H Alderson.
D. H. 奥尔德森夫妇
- Hello, Mrs Miles.
in AM, use 美国英语用 Mrs.
